aboutsummaryrefslogtreecommitdiffstats
path: root/tests/internals
diff options
context:
space:
mode:
Diffstat (limited to 'tests/internals')
-rwxr-xr-xtests/internals/test_internals_valgrind.sh4
-rwxr-xr-xtests/internals/test_rate_limiter_valgrind.sh4
2 files changed, 6 insertions, 2 deletions
diff --git a/tests/internals/test_internals_valgrind.sh b/tests/internals/test_internals_valgrind.sh
index a84c664..4511ccd 100755
--- a/tests/internals/test_internals_valgrind.sh
+++ b/tests/internals/test_internals_valgrind.sh
@@ -1,3 +1,5 @@
#!/bin/sh
-cd `dirname "$0"`
+if [ ! -x ./test_internals ]; then
+ cd `dirname "$0"`
+fi
valgrind --error-exitcode=100 ./test_internals
diff --git a/tests/internals/test_rate_limiter_valgrind.sh b/tests/internals/test_rate_limiter_valgrind.sh
index e291360..bf0a7cd 100755
--- a/tests/internals/test_rate_limiter_valgrind.sh
+++ b/tests/internals/test_rate_limiter_valgrind.sh
@@ -1,3 +1,5 @@
#!/bin/sh
-cd `dirname "$0"`
+if [ ! -x ./test_rate_limiter ]; then
+ cd `dirname "$0"`
+fi
valgrind --error-exitcode=100 ./test_rate_limiter